Soil Type
The Marisco Vineyard soils in the Waihopai Valley are very complex soils with less fertility and uniformity than those of the northern side of the Wairau Valley. The climate has a bigger diurnal range, with warmer days and cooler nights. This combination of soils and climate allow us to produce classical styles of Sauvignon Blanc showing elegance and fruit purity.The low fertility of the soils allows us to control the vigour of our vines, and the complexity gives us the opportunity to have different aromatic and flavour profiles across the vineyard.
